In Helnwein's series of paintings entitled ‘Head of a Child,’ the child serves as a mirror for social conditions, historical violence and collective trauma. Helnwein himself explains his understanding of this concept: ‘For me, children are a great miracle ... it is only important to protect them from the methods of education and indoctrination used by the corrupt adult world.’
